**Q: Pick-list optimizer release gating?**

PathBinder's optimizer ships behind the `pb_route_v4` flag. Do not flip it fleet-wide; roll out per-warehouse, starting with the Kestrel Falls site. Key checks: pick time p95 under 140s, zero route loops in the audit log, and bin-conflict rate below 0.2%. Rollback is flag-off plus a cache flush — no redeploy needed. Optimizer changes freeze 48 hours before peak season cutover. Release notes must list any heuristic weight changes. For gating exceptions during freeze, email the optimizer lead.

billing contact of yawip-yadup = druath.casdor@nelvrolabs.internal

## Meridian Tier — Overview (Managers Only)

This page summarises the proposed Meridian subscription tier for Quillhaven Software, prepared for board review. Meridian sits above our current Harbor plan, adding priority provisioning, extended retention, and the Atlascope reporting module. Pricing modelling assumes a 22% uplift over Harbor with a projected 9% attach rate in year one. Rollout would begin with the Eastvale customer segment. The commercial rationale and sequencing are set out in the note directly below.

internal memo for bahap-yagug: Headcount on the Ulaix team goes from 3 to 100 by the end of January. Gross margin on Ulaix came in at 10 percent against a plan of 15 percent.

**CI note — Thumbnail queue stalls on Pixelbarn runners**

The thumbnail generation queue in Snapmill occasionally stalls when the resizer container starts before the broker health check passes. Symptom: jobs sit in PENDING for 10+ minutes, then fail in bulk. Workaround: re-run the pipeline with the broker warm-up stage enabled. A permanent startup-ordering fix is in review. The affected runner image build is noted below.

session token of kafof-kafop = htk31_c3becf8b8eac3ed970037fba36e258e

## Runbook: Cron migration to Driftwheel

We are moving the remaining nightly cron jobs off the Pellam box and into the Driftwheel workflow engine. Support should expect job notifications to come from Driftwheel alerts instead of cron mail. Retries are now automatic, so do not manually rerun a failed job until the third retry has fired. When triaging, compare the live scheduler settings against the expected values shown below.

service settings:
[casax]
port = 6379
team = rusir
host = casax.zemvarhq.corp
region = outer-4
access_code = ac_9808ce
timeout_ms = 1500